- 17th July, 2025
- By Aiden Clarke
Your Ultimate Guide to Car Rental in Tokyo, JP: Drive with Confidence in Japan’s Bustling Metropolis
Discover how to rent a car in Tokyo, JP with ease. Compare top providers, learn local driving rules, and get tips to navigate Japan’s vibrant streets confidently.
read more